On June 10, acclaimed British actress Emma Samms, MBE, participated in an in-person fan event at Rockwells in Pelham, New York.
This event was organized by Coastal Entertainment, and she was joined by an intimate group of fans. Samms shared behind-the-scenes stories about playing her popular characters Holly Sutton on the ABC soap opera “General Hospital,” and Fallon Carrington on “Dynasty” respectively.
She was also candid about her health battle with long COVID.

Recalling the ‘Dynasty’ virtual reunion fundraiser.
Samms noted that she was thrilled with the success of the virtual “Dynasty” Zoom, which took place in March of 2021, which celebrated the 40th anniversary of the hit primetime drama.
Over 600 participants attended via Zoom, and it raised money towards a great cause, which helps fund research on the mysterious long-term symptoms of COVID. “That Zoom was such a treat,” she admitted. “I hadn’t seen most of those actors for a long time. We were even able to bring in some surprises.”

Maurice Benard’s MB ‘State of Mind’ podcast
In October of 2022, Samms was featured in Maurice Benard’s MB “State of Mind” podcast on mental health, where they spoke about long COVID and mental health.
